Josh Green’s Return: A Catalyst for Change in Charlotte

Entering the current season, the Charlotte Hornets had aspirations of vying for a playoff berth. After years of struggling, even a shot at the play-in tournament felt attainable. However, the reality has been starkly different. As of now, the team finds itself languishing in 12th place in the Eastern Conference, raising urgent questions about the path forward.

Josh Green’s Impact on the Roster

In a bid to revitalize their season, the Hornets are set to welcome back Josh Green into their rotation. The return of a guard known for his defensive tenacity and three-point shooting could provide the much-needed boost the team desperately craves. But with Green’s comeback on the horizon, the focus shifts to roster adjustments—specifically, who will see their minutes reduced.

Sion James is likely to experience a decrease in playing time, primarily due to his role not aligning with the starting lineup upon Green’s return. This predicament is particularly pronounced on nights when LaMelo Ball and Brandon Miller are sidelined, which has unfortunately become a recurring theme. In these instances, Green can seamlessly slide into a starting role, offering a more reliable option.

Another player potentially at risk is rookie Liam McNeeley. While McNeeley has shown flashes of improvement, his offensive struggles have been evident, making Green’s return a likely upgrade. The Hornets currently rank as one of the weakest defensive teams in the league, sitting at seventh from the bottom. Green’s defensive prowess could be the antidote they need, filling a void that McNeeley has yet to adequately address.

Tanking on the Horizon?

If the Hornets fail to turn their fortunes around swiftly, the team may need to consider a more drastic approach: tanking. The All-Star break could serve as a pivotal moment for Charlotte, potentially nudging them toward a rebuilding mindset. Recent trade rumors surrounding LaMelo Ball have added fuel to this speculation. If the franchise decides to part ways with its star guard, it’s likely that a tanking strategy would follow, perhaps even organically.

While Green’s return is a positive development, it alone will not be enough to transform the Hornets into contenders. The team also needs its key players, notably Miller, to return to full health and perform at their best. The clock is ticking for Charlotte, and the upcoming weeks will be critical in determining whether they remain competitive or begin to pivot toward a new chapter in their franchise history.
